1. They’re Not Just Buying: They’re Signaling

For high-end clients, every purchase tells a story.

  • The luxury car says “I’ve arrived.”
  • The $500 facial says “I take care of myself.”
  • The premium consultant says “I mean business.”

These buyers aren’t shopping for function, they’re shopping for identity. Your pricing becomes a signal of value, and your brand becomes a mirror reflecting their own aspirations.

💡 How to Attract Them:
Position your brand to reflect their desired identity. Speak to ambition, legacy, lifestyle, not just features. Sell the dream, then back it up with undeniable results.


2. They Value Time Over Money

High-paying clients think in terms of ROI and not savings.

They’re not interested in the cheapest option. They’re interested in who gets them there faster, better, and with peace of mind. They’re not afraid of investing in excellence, because they know the cost of cheap mistakes.

💡 How to Attract Them:
Show them how you save time, amplify results, and reduce stress. Use testimonials, case studies, and clear outcomes to demonstrate that your price is actually a shortcut.


3. They Crave Exclusivity and Excellence

People will always pay more for what feels rare and refined.
Think about it… why do people pay $10,000+ for a Hermès bag when a tote could do the job? Because accessibility kills allure.

💡 How to Attract Them:
Make your offering feel selective and elevated.
Use intentional branding, professional design, luxury cues, and scarcity (limited spots, application-only, premium tiers). Excellence should look and feel exclusive.


4. They Trust Themselves to Decide

Premium clients are decisive. They don’t need you to sell them; they need you to show up like the expert you are. If your energy is unsure, apologetic, or discount-driven; they’ll walk away.

💡 How to Attract Them:
Step into confidence energy. Own your worth.
Communicate like a leader. Price with intention. Make it clear: this isn’t for everyone, and that’s the point.
